This bug seems fixed as of xemacs21-basesupport version
2002.03.29-1. It is impossible to reproduce. I believe you can close
this bug.
I have used EFS to succesfully access files on a FreeBSD 4.10-STABLE
system with a password that contains the '@' character. It works fine.
I've also tried running xemacs with exactly the same format as
suggested in the bug report with bash on a sarge system (and this
suggest that a different problem being reported than '@' in the
password, but here goes anyway):
xemacs /`whoami`@localhost:.
and this bought up dired on my home directory as expected.
